The Grade at Every Visit Is the Point

Pet dental care in Central Frisco is available at Petfolk on Main St, and it starts before your pet ever goes under anesthesia. At every wellness visit, the veterinarian grades the teeth on a zero-to-four scale and records it. A Central Frisco dog who was a grade one two years ago and is now a grade three has been accumulating disease the whole time, and the record shows it. That grade tells you when a cleaning is actually necessary, not when someone asks if you'd like to add dental.

When a cleaning is needed, it's done under general anesthesia with a full intraoral X-ray series. Central Frisco pets often eat a mix of wet food, table scraps, and commercial treats, which accelerates tartar and gum disease faster than dry-only diets. Intraoral X-rays find damage below the gumline that a surface clean would miss and that leaves roots rotting under what looks like a clean crown. Pre-anesthesia bloodwork is required every time.
